In 1850, Pvt. Hardy M. Smith entered the world in Laurens County, Georgia, born to Hamilton William Smith And Margaret Annie Covington. In 1880, Pvt. Hardy M. Smith resided in Buckeye, Laurens, Georgia, United States. Pvt. Hardy M. Smith married Elizabeth Lizzie Davis Smith, and had children including Estella Smith, Sidney Smith, William Hardy Smith, Winfield Berrien Smith. Pvt. Hardy M. Smith passed away in 1890 in Laurens County, Georgia.
